Output ecda244be6ae015df530d9cbd3ba1b044271c99057491aa7cf825ea6733091e0:4

value
120223390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ec2915103db15159a1adf3fe7c0a72c04cfea3 OP_EQUAL
address
MW8uLmBkCdz3y4ijFgM1BNjRTrPHq7UZqr
transaction
ecda244be6ae015df530d9cbd3ba1b044271c99057491aa7cf825ea6733091e0
spent
true